Eligibility Requirements
Academic Qualifications
- Applicants must possess a Bachelor’s Degree from an accredited university.
- All candidates must be proficient in Bengali, except those whose first language is Nepali.
Age Criteria (as of January 1, 2024)
Group | Age Range |
---|---|
Group A & C | 21–36 years |
Group B | 20–36 years |
Group D | 21–39 years |
Age Relaxation
Candidates from specific categories are eligible for relaxation in the upper age limit:
- SC/ST Candidates (West Bengal): 5 years
- OBC (Non-Creamy Layer): 3 years
Note: ST/SC/OBC candidates from states outside West Bengal will be treated as General category candidates and will not be eligible for relaxation.
Application Fee Structure
The application fee structure varies based on the candidate’s category.
Category | Fee Amount |
---|---|
SC/ST (West Bengal) | Exempted |
PwBD Candidates | Exempted |
General & OBC | ₹200 + applicable charges |

Step-by-Step Selection Process
The WBCS hiring procedure involves a multi-stage evaluation to identify the best candidates for administrative roles.
Stage 1: Preliminary Examination
- This is an objective-type test with multiple-choice questions.
- Functions as a screening phase to narrow down candidates for the Main Examination.
Stage 2: Main Examination
- Comprises a mix of descriptive and objective questions.
- Incorporates elective subjects selected by candidates according to their desired service group.
Stage 3: Personality Test
- Candidates who qualify for the Mains are invited for the Personality Test.
- This stage assesses traits like communication skills, decision-making abilities, and fitness for administrative positions.
Stage 4: Final Merit List
- The ultimate choice relies on the Main Examination and the Personality Test results.
How to Apply Online
Here’s a detailed guide to submitting your application for the WBCS Examination 2024:
- Visit the Official Portal: Open psc.wb.gov.in in your browser.
- Register as a New User: Create an account with a valid email ID and mobile number.
- Log In to Your Account: Use your registered credentials to access the application form.
- Complete the Application Form: Accurately enter your details, educational qualifications, and contact information.
- Upload Necessary Documents: Kindly attach scanned copies of your recent passport-sized photo and signature using the required format.
- Pay the Application Fee: Finalize the fee payment using your preferred method. (online banking, UPI, or card).
- Verify and Submit: Verify all provided information and submit the form.
- Print Confirmation: Save and print the application acknowledgement for future use.
